A 12-Year-Old Was Nominated for ‘Worst Actor’ At The Razzie Awards

The Razzie Awards strike again! Although the Oscars have announced their nominations, which is very interesting this year, the Razzie Awards do the same thing as every year. However, contrary to the Oscars which remain a much-appreciated despite criticism ceremony, the Razzie Awards seem to be mostly hated because of how poorly they choose their categories.

And this year, people were very angry with them on social media, because the Razzies decided to nominate Ryan Kiera Armstrong for the “Worst Actor” category. What’s the problem? He is only 12 years old, and when we know how embarrassing this ceremony is, It is very disturbing to hear it.

What He Was Nominated For

Directed by Keith Thomas, Firestarter is one of the popular movies of 2022 with Zac Efron as the lead actor along with 12-year-old actress Ryan Kiera Armstrong. Adapted from Stephen King’s novel released in 1984, the story is about Charlie, who can use pyrokinesis with ease. However, he is followed by an organization that wants to capture him to create a weapon from his powers.

The film has been widely criticized for its lack of suspense, and the writing and even lack of horror for a horror film adapted from a Stephen King novel. So there is a real reason why it has been nominated at the famous Razzie Awards. However, is that fair to shame a 12-year-old actor who is not actually responsible for the quality of the film? Of course not! And that’s why people are so angry, and It’s not the first time.

Why People Hate the Razzie Awards

While It could be a little funny in the past, the Razzies don’t make anyone laugh anymore for certain bad decisions that destroy entire careers and lives. And they should learn a lesson because the last time they nominated a kid for the Razzies, it didn’t end well for him.

Do you remember Jake Lloyd? Of course, fans of the Star Wars franchise would say yes, but it was he who played the role of young Anakin Skywalker in Star Wars I: The Phantom Menace. He was nominated for worst actor and won. People would after mock him and It stopped his career at a very young age when he might have had a bright future.

But It didn’t just end his career, it also affected his life a lot and that’s why the Razzie Awards are now considered a problem. Jake Lloyd was bullied at school for his role, and his life became hell very early on. He was traumatized by the cameras and could no longer play in front of them. Recently, he was diagnosed Schizophrenic and placed in a mental hospital. And most people think it’s partly because of the Razzies. Probably not, but one thing is certain, they participated in the bullying of the young actor.

Not Taken Seriously Since A Moment

The Razzie Awards are now hated, but before that, they weren’t taken seriously at all. why? Because for their first ceremony in 1981, they nominated Stanley Kubrick in the ‘Worst Director’ category for… The Shining. Does it really need an explanation? Of course not. Anyone who has seen the film, whether you like it or not, objectively knows that it remains a masterpiece and an example for many cinematographers. Another example of the same category is Brain de Palma nominated for Scarface.

In 2015, to restore a bit of their reputation, they decided to nominate Ben Affleck in a category called ‘Redemption’ to apologize for their critics of him. He was nominated in it for his great roles in ‘Gone Girl’ and ‘Argo’. And people on the internet love the initiative, especially Ben Affleck who is a very appreciated actor.

But recently, the Razzie Awards once again became controversial by creating a category just for Bruce Willis to poke fun at. Very bad timing, because the actor’s family announced a few days before Bruce Willis decided to end his career because he has aphasia. And this year, nominating a 12-year-old is, like so many other times, one of the worst ideas the Razzies have ever had. People still wonder today why it still exists. Well, everyone talks about it every year, even if they hate it. And maybe that’s why the Razzie Awards ceremony still exists today. And it fits their sarcasm.
